Dow Jones Transportation Index (DJT) Near Upside Breakout in 2025: Dow Theory Signal Traders Are Watching

According to @RhythmicAnalyst, the Dow Jones Transportation Index is approaching an upside breakout, highlighting a potential bullish confirmation level for transports (source: @RhythmicAnalyst). According to @RhythmicAnalyst, this setup is a positive signal for the U.S. economy that traders may watch for confirmation (source: @RhythmicAnalyst). According to @RhythmicAnalyst, under Dow Theory the Transportation Index functions as a secondary or supplementary market indicator, so a breakout could serve as confirmation alongside other indices (source: @RhythmicAnalyst). For crypto market participants, the source does not cite a direct crypto impact; it should be treated as a macro backdrop signal only (source: @RhythmicAnalyst).
